One ... crai villasimiusWebJul 18, 2024 · 17th Amendment to the U.S. Constitution: Direct Election of U.S. Senators En Español Americans did not directly vote for senators for the first 125 years of the Federal Government. The Constitution, as it was adopted in 1788, stated that senators would be elected by state legislatures. magsafe do iphone 13WebJan 11, 2024 · The 17Th Amendment Is The Only One To Substantially Change The Structure Of Congress.
